GREENSBORO, N.C. Maria Perezs fate isnt clear right now.
The mother of three young girls has lived in the Alamance County for the past decade.
Shes often known as provider.
Perez also takes care of her elderly father who suffers from glaucoma.
Perez is set to be deported back to Mexico on December 27th ripping her away from the family that loves her so much.
Perez turned to the North Carolina Dream Team for help
